Conjugate cristalizar in Spanish
to crystallize
cristalizar is a regular -ar verb ranked #1829 among the most common Spanish verbs. For example: "La sal se cristaliza cuando el agua se evapora." (The salt crystallizes when the water evaporates.). Use the tables below for full conjugation across all 7 tenses.

Describes current actions, habits, and general truths. The most frequently used tense — master it first.
| Pronoun | Conjugation |
|---|---|
| yo | cristalizo |
| tú | cristalizas |
| él/ella/Ud. | cristaliza |
| nosotros | cristalizamos |
| vosotros | cristalizáis |
| ellos/ellas/Uds. | cristalizan |
La sal se cristaliza cuando el agua se evapora.
The salt crystallizes when the water evaporates.
Describes completed past actions with a clear start and end. Key signals: ayer, el lunes pasado, de repente.
| Pronoun | Conjugation |
|---|---|
| yo | cristalicé |
| tú | cristalizaste |
| él/ella/Ud. | cristalizó |
| nosotros | cristalizamos |
| vosotros | cristalizasteis |
| ellos/ellas/Uds. | cristalizaron |
Sus ideas cristalizaron en un proyecto concreto.
His ideas crystallized into a concrete project.

Describes future events and predictions. In everyday speech, ir a + infinitive is often preferred for planned events.
| Pronoun | Conjugation |
|---|---|
| yo | cristalizaré |
| tú | cristalizarás |
| él/ella/Ud. | cristalizará |
| nosotros | cristalizaremos |
| vosotros | cristalizaréis |
| ellos/ellas/Uds. | cristalizarán |

Used in clauses expressing wishes, doubt, emotion, or uncertainty — typically after que. Triggers: querer, esperar, dudar, ojalá.
| Pronoun | Conjugation |
|---|---|
| yo | cristalice |
| tú | cristalices |
| él/ella/Ud. | cristalice |
| nosotros | cristalicemos |
| vosotros | cristalicéis |
| ellos/ellas/Uds. | cristalicen |

Common phrases with cristalizar
- cristalizar una idea to crystallize an idea
- cristalizar en algo concreto to crystallize into something concrete
- cristalizar los sueños to make dreams come true
